#2c5922 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2c5922 is composed of 17.3% red, 34.9%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.8%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 109.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.7% and a lightness of 24.1%. #2c5922 color hex could be obtained by blending #58b244 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#2c5922

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c5922

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b413a is the less saturated color, while #177a01 is the most saturated one.
